Step #1: Assess the Metal. Step #2: Clean and Prep. Step #3: Pick Your Products. Step #4: If Rusted, Prime the Metal Furniture. Step #5: Paint the Metal Furniture. Step #6: Let Dry and Apply a Second Coat.

WebMar 15, 2024 · 1. Scrape off light, loose rust with a wire brush. If you’re dealing with a lightly rusted surface, you may just need to give it a quick scrub with a brush. A paint scraper or metal putty knife may also do the trick. Scrape off peeling paint and powdery, flaking rust until the surface is mostly smooth. [1] WebDon’t let the rust dissolver dry. Keep reapplying it, if needed, but be sure to remove it within 10-30 minutes. Only apply the rust dissolver where you need it: on the rusty metal spots. If …
